Technical Division




Probabilistic Methods Committee


 

Purpose: To promote and foster research in uncertainty analysis, model validation methods, and risk-informed decision-making, and to stimulate its understanding and use in science and engineering applications to benefit society.

Sankaran Mahadevan, M.ASCE, Chair

Student Paper Award for Probabilistic Methods Papers at ASCE/EMI  Engineering Mechanics Conferences

The EMI Board of Governors recently approved the request of the Probabilistic Mechanics Committee to approve the rules it proposed for a Student Paper Award for Probabilistic Mechanics Papers.  The rules for forming the Awards Sub-Committee, judging papers, and making a student paper award for the best paper incorporating probabilistic methods at the annual engineering mechanics conference sponsored by the Engineering Mechanics Institute of ASCE can be found here.

ICOSSAR'09

The 10th International Conference and Structural Safety and Reliability (ICOSSAR'09) will be held at Kansai University in Osaka, Japan, September 13-19, 2009. The abstract submission deadline has been extended until May 31. Please submit abstracts and session or symposium proposals prior to May 31, 2008 to the conference. 4th Biot Conference on Poromechanics

The 4th Biot Conference on Poromechanics will be held at Columbia University June 8-10, 2009. Single page abstracts are due by May 31, 2008 and can be submitted to the conference via e-mail: biot@civil.columbia.edu. More information can be found at http://www.civil.columbia.edu/biot/
